Josh Morrissey #226 (Hockey Cards 2016 Upper Deck) — is it worth grading?

Is Josh Morrissey #226 worth grading?

Hockey · Hockey Cards 2016 Upper Deck · full price guide →

Strong grading candidate — 12× premium in PSA 10

A PSA 10 Josh Morrissey #226 sells for $60.29 against $4.99 raw: a $55.30 spread, 12× the ungraded price. A PSA 9 ($20.03) only about breaks even after fees, so the case rests on gemming. Centering is the usual reason a clean copy misses the 10 — measure it before you submit.

Break-even by outcome and fee

Josh Morrissey #226: net result of grading versus selling raw, by outcome and fee tier
If it comes back…Sells forEconomy / bulk (~$25.00)Standard (~$50.00)Express (~$150)
Gem — PSA 10$60.29+$30.30+$5.30−$94.70
PSA 9$20.03−$9.96−$34.96−$135
PSA 8$6.94−$23.05−$48.05−$148

Net = sale price − $4.99 raw value − fee. Fee tiers are illustrative; plug your grader's current price into the calculator below.

Which grader pays the most — and what a 10 takes

All centering standards
Josh Morrissey #226: top-grade value by grading company with centering tolerance
Grader10 sells forvs bestFront centering for a 10Back
BGS 10$78.00best55/4570/30
PSA 10$60.29−$17.7155/4575/25
CGC 10$50.00−$28.0055/4575/25
SGC 10$25.02−$52.9855/4575/25

Tolerances are each company's published centering standard for its top grade; surface, corners and edges must also be clean. Centering is the one you can measure yourself before you pay.
